Regulatory Challenges for Stablecoin Adoption in Asia

Let’s talk compliance. Every country has its own set of rules, and some are more complicated than others.

Hong Kong

Take Hong Kong, for instance. If you want to issue a HKD stablecoin, good luck. You need a license from the Hong Kong Monetary Authority (HKMA). Not to mention, the capital requirements are hefty: HK$25 million in paid-up capital and HK$3 million in liquid capital, plus 100% reserves in high-quality assets. For companies that aren't using approved tokens, this is a nightmare. Payroll integration is going to be a costly compliance mess.

South Korea

Then there's South Korea, where the Digital Asset Basic Law is on hold until 2026 because the Financial Services Commission (FSC) and the Bank of Korea (BOK) can't agree on anything. So much uncertainty around reserve oversight and enforcement. This is a killer for KRW payroll. Businesses must maintain full reserve backing exceeding 100%, which is a costly affair.

Japan

Japan is playing it super safe too, with a strict 100% yen reserve requirement for any stablecoin used in institutional settings. They don't care about retail or payroll adoption, which makes it slower to integrate into those systems.

Singapore

Now let's look at Singapore. The MAS requires that stablecoins are 100% backed by SGD or G10 currencies, and you must comply with AML/CFT rules. This just adds layers to payroll compliance that aren't present with standard crypto regulations. Scalability? Forget it.

The Intersection of Crypto and HR: Tools and Platforms to Know

Despite all this, there are fintech startups in Asia using stablecoins to streamline payroll. Companies like StraitsX are embedding them into payment platforms. You can settle instantly and bypass the traditional banking system. Workers get paid on time, and merchants can accept payments without waiting for bank transfers.

Advantages of Using Stablecoins for Payroll

Why are companies looking to stablecoins? Instant payments, wage stability, and ease of access. Cutting out the banks means happier employees and better cash flow for businesses.
